The items displayed on screen are as follows:
Item
Index
Date
Time
Error Code
Sub Code
Error Message
Function
Displays minor errors, which affect only a certain part of system
operation.
Displays major errors, which affect operation of the whole system,
or result in system failure.
Erases the stored error log information from both the screen and
the PBX.
Description
The ordinal number assigned to an error record in the current log.
The date of the error detection.
The time of the error detection.
The 3-digit error code assigned by the PBX.
The 5-digit sub code of the relevant hardware. (XYYZZ)
X: Shelf number
KX-TDA50/KX-TDA100/KX-TDA200: 1
KX-TDA600:
1: Basic Shelf
2: Expansion Shelf 1
3: Expansion Shelf 2
4: Expansion Shelf 3
YY: Slot number
KX-TDA50: 00 to 11 (00: MPR slot; 01: Fixed slot, 02 to
04: Free slot type A, 05 to 07: Free slot type B, 08 to 11:
Option slot)
KX-TDA100: 00 to 06 (00: MPR slot; 01 to 06: Free slot)
KX-TDA200: 00 to 11 (00: MPR slot; 01 to 11: Free slot)
KX-TDA600:
Basic Shelf: 00 to 10
(00: EMPR Card Slot; 01 to 10: Free Slots)
Expansion Shelf: 01 to 12
(01 to 11: Free Slots; 12: BUS-S Card Slot)
ZZ: Physical port number (01 to 16)
For OPB3 card, sub slot number (1 to 3) + port number (1
to 4) will be displayed as follows:
Sub slot 1 of OPB3: 11 to 14
Sub slot 2 of OPB3: 21 to 24
Sub slot 3 of OPB3: 31 to 34
A description of the error.
